Valery Alekseyevich Legasov was a Soviet inorganic chemist, professor at Moscow State University, first deputy director of the Kurchatov Institute of Atomic Energy, and a member of the Academy of Sciences of the Soviet Union.
Soviet nuclear chemist, chief of the commission investigating the Chernobyl disaster (1936-1988)
